Bank of America Corp. reduced Chief Executive Kenneth Lewis’ total compensation in 2008 by 60% to $9.96 million after the company missed its performance targets.

The package included $1.5 million in salary, unchanged from the previous year, and no bonus, according to a federal filing by the Charlotte, N.C., bank.

Lewis, 61, had total 2007 compensation of $24.8 million under Securities and Exchange Commission reporting rules.
